Bail Bond Premiums:

Most states, including California, are regulated by the Department Of Insurance which sets and monitors the rates charged by bail bond companies. In California, premium rates are set at 10% of the bail bond. For example, if the bail bond is $15,000 then the rate charged by the bail bond company is $1,500.

Collateral:

Sometimes bail companies use collateral to ensure their clients show up for all necessary court appearances and fulfill the terms of their bail contracts. Collateral is usually in the form of cash or real estate. If the client fails to appear in court, the court will order a "forfeiture" of the bond and the bail company will use the collateral to pay back the debt.
